Taco Bell Nacho Cheese Sauce

Indulge in the irresistible taste of Taco Bell Nacho Cheese Sauce with this easy recipe! Perfect for dipping your favorite tortilla chips or drizzling over nachos, this cheesy sauce is sure to be a hit at your next gathering.

Ingredients:

  • 1 cup cheddar cheese, grated
  • 1/2 cup milk
  • 1 tablespoon butter
  • 1 tablespoon all-purpose flour
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on chili powder

Instructions:

  • In a saucepan, melt butter over medium heat.
  • Stir in flour and cook for 1 minute.
  • Gradually whisk in milk until smooth.
  • Add grated cheese, salt, and chili powder, stirring until cheese is melted and sauce is smooth.
  • Serve warm and enjoy!

Popular questions:

    • Q: Can I use a different type of cheese for this recipe?

A: Yes, you can experiment with different types of cheese to find the flavor that suits your taste preferences.

    • Q: Can I make this sauce ahead of time?

A: This sauce is best served fresh, but you can reheat it gently on the stove or in the microwave if needed.

    • Q: Can I make this sauce spicy?

A: You can adjust the amount of chili powder to make the sauce as spicy as you like.

Helpful tips:

  • Try adding diced jalapenos or salsa for an extra kick of flavor.
  • For a creamier texture, use heavy cream instead of milk.
  • Drizzle this sauce over French fries for a delicious twist on cheese fries.

Expert Secrets:

  • To prevent the sauce from becoming grainy, make sure to whisk constantly while adding the cheese.
  • If the sauce is too thick, you can thin it out with a little more milk.
  • For a richer flavor, use aged cheddar cheese instead of mild cheddar.
